Resumen del Editor

From Syrie James, the best-selling author of The Lost Memoirs of Jane Austen, comes a novel that captures the passionate heart and restless soul of Charlotte Brontë—the author who gave the world Jane Eyre while longing for a soulmate.

I fell in love with the Bronte sisters.

I have read the reviews by others who had difficulties with the author's retelling of Charlotte's story because of the inaccuracies. If I were a Bronte scholar - If I were even a Victorian Literature scholar - I might feel the same and therefore deduct a star. However, this book was my introduction to the Bronte sisters. I had never read any of their works or any biographies about them. And this book made me fall in love with them. That fact alone makes me feel it is worthy of 4 stars. And because of this book I have already read Wuthering Heights and Jane Eyre is up next, so 4 stars may be stingy.

Bianca Amato's voice was beautiful. I do not know whether the accent was correct, but as a modern day American it sounded right to my ear. I found her voicing of the sisters to be strong and unique, which seemed to be the right choice for their characters.

I Love This Book.

DELIGHTFUL! Written well. Researched. Narrated AMAZINGLY! This book was like spending 10 years with Charlotte Bronte as a companion and interacting with her amazing sisters, her bitter brother, her taciturn father, her bestie Ellen, her Mr. Nichols and blossoming friendship with Elizabeth Gaskell. This book was emotional, bouncing between cheerful and heartbreaking at all times. But when it came time for Charlotte to endure her brother's and sisters deaths, it was painful. This poor woman suffered as much as she won. **SPOILERS** The two best parts of this book were: 1) The Bronte sisters discussing Jane Austen's "Pride and Prejudice" after reading it. Total literary-gasm. 2) Jane's wedding night. I blushed. No it wasn't graphic, but my inner victorian lady was quite aghast. This book takes place during the sisters publishing of their books, which is nerve-wrecking and exciting all at once. All in all, this is a very good listen. The narrator is brilliant.
